The fifth generation of wireless technology, or 5G, is transforming how we connect, communicate, and use mobile applications. With its super-fast speeds, ultra-low latency, and enhanced connectivity, 5G is a game-changer for Android app development. It unlocks endless possibilities, enabling developers to create apps that are faster, more responsive, and packed with innovative features.
In this blog, weβll explore what 5G means for Android apps, the opportunities it presents, and how developers can leverage its potential to create groundbreaking applications.
What is 5G, and How is it Different?
5G is the latest generation of wireless network technology. Unlike its predecessor, 4G, which provided the foundation for apps like video streaming and social media, 5G offers much higher data transfer speeds (up to 10 Gbps), significantly lower latency (under 1 millisecond), and the capacity to connect millions of devices simultaneously.
Key Features of 5G
- Speed: 5G is up to 100 times faster than 4G, enabling instantaneous downloads and real-time data transmission.
- Latency: Latency is the time it takes for data to travel between devices. With 5G, latency is reduced to nearly zero, making apps highly responsive.
- Capacity: 5G supports a massive number of connections, ideal for IoT devices, wearables, and smart cities.
- Reliability: 5G networks are more stable and less prone to disruptions, ensuring a seamless user experience.
Opportunities 5G Brings to Android Apps
With 5G, Android app developers can push boundaries and create applications that were previously unimaginable. Here's a closer look at how 5G will enhance various app categories:
1. Enhanced Video Streaming
- Ultra-HD Streaming: 5G enables smooth streaming of 4K and 8K videos without buffering.
- Cloud Gaming: High-speed networks allow users to play graphics-intensive games directly from the cloud without downloading.
- Live Streaming: Real-time, high-definition live streaming for events, gaming, and social media becomes flawless with 5G.
2. Augmented Reality (AR) and Virtual Reality (VR)
- Immersive Experiences: 5G makes AR and VR apps more responsive, enabling real-time interaction with virtual objects.
- Education and Training: Apps that simulate real-world scenarios, like medical surgeries or mechanical repairs, become more viable.
- Gaming: Multiplayer AR/VR games with minimal latency are now possible.
3. IoT and Smart Devices
- Smart Homes: Apps that control IoT devices, like smart thermostats or security systems, will perform faster and more reliably.
- Wearables: Health monitoring apps connected to wearable devices can provide real-time updates and analytics.
- Connected Cars: Android apps for navigation and vehicle diagnostics will benefit from 5Gβs low latency.
4. Real-Time Communication
- Video Calls: Apps like Zoom or Google Meet will offer smoother, high-definition video calls without delays.
- Collaboration Tools: Teams can collaborate on large files or live projects seamlessly.
- Live Translation: Real-time language translation apps become more efficient with faster data processing.
5. Gaming Apps
- Cloud Gaming: 5G eliminates the need for powerful devices by enabling users to play high-quality games directly from the cloud.
- Multiplayer Games: Reduced latency ensures better synchronization in multiplayer environments.
- AR/VR Games: Games that use AR/VR can now offer richer and more interactive environments.
6. Health and Fitness Apps
- Remote Monitoring: Health apps can send real-time data from wearable devices to doctors.
- Telemedicine: Video consultations and remote diagnostics improve in quality.
- AI-Powered Fitness Coaches: Faster connectivity enables instant feedback and recommendations.
Challenges for Developers
While 5G offers numerous advantages, it also comes with its own set of challenges:
- Compatibility: Not all devices are 5G-enabled, so developers must ensure backward compatibility with 4G networks.
- Cost: Developing apps that fully utilize 5G capabilities can be resource-intensive.
- Battery Consumption: High-speed apps often drain battery life faster, so optimizing power usage is crucial.
- Security: More connected devices mean higher risks of cyberattacks, necessitating robust security measures.
Best Practices for Leveraging 5G in Android Apps
Hereβs how developers can make the most of 5G technology in their Android apps:
1. Optimize for Speed and Latency
- Design apps to take advantage of 5G's low latency for real-time interactions.
- Optimize data usage to prevent overloading the network.
2. Focus on User Experience
- Enhance graphics, animations, and video quality to utilize the high bandwidth of 5G.
- Reduce loading times and improve in-app navigation.
3. Leverage Edge Computing
- Process data closer to users via edge computing, reducing latency further.
- Use cloud-based solutions for heavy computational tasks.
4. Incorporate AR/VR Features
- Integrate AR/VR capabilities for gaming, education, and retail apps.
- Develop immersive experiences that utilize 5Gβs high-speed connectivity.
5. Implement Security Measures
- Use encryption, authentication, and secure APIs to protect user data.
- Regularly update apps to address emerging security vulnerabilities.
Future of 5G in Android Apps
As 5G adoption increases, its impact on Android apps will become more profound. Here are a few predictions:
- AI-Powered Apps: Apps with AI capabilities, like real-time object detection or voice recognition, will thrive with 5Gβs speed and efficiency.
- Smart Cities: Apps that interact with urban infrastructure, like traffic management or public safety, will become common.
- Next-Gen Gaming: Cloud-based multiplayer gaming and e-sports apps will dominate the market.
- Healthcare Revolution: Apps for telemedicine, remote surgeries, and real-time diagnostics will redefine healthcare.
Conclusion
The rollout of 5G is a turning point for Android app development, unlocking unparalleled opportunities for innovation and user engagement. Whether itβs delivering ultra-HD streaming, enabling real-time AR/VR experiences, or revolutionizing IoT applications, 5G is set to redefine what Android apps can achieve.
The 5G revolution is here, and itβs time to build apps that make the most of this transformative technology!
Written by Hexadecimal Software
Top comments (0)